摘要
Clay hybrid films were obtained by the solution blending of saponite (SPT) with various amounts of poly(vinyl alcohol) (PVA). Variations in the thermal properties, morphology, optical transparency, and gas permeability of the clay hybrid films with PVA content in the range 0-10 wt% were examined. With increasing PVA content, the thermal transition temperatures of the hybrids decreased. However, the values of the coefficient of thermal expansion (CTE) increased gradually. The values of the yellow index (YI) and oxygen transmission rate (O2TR) of the clay hybrid films remained constant regardless of their PVA content.
